FRANCE, Bourdillon Medal, 1781, in silver (31mm) obverse, two hands in greeting, above, 'La / Vraie Gloire / Nait / De La Vertu', below, 'De L'Auditeur / Bourdillon / Le Plaisir Fut / L'Union ' 1781', reverse, Bourdillon arms. Uncirculated.

With contemporary hand written note stating that the medal was stuck at Geneva in honour of Mons. Bourdillon, auditor of the city.
